Sugaynik otruyny – poisonous doronicum

Name: Sugaynik otruyny – poisonous doronicum

brittle loaf (Doronicum pardalianches); doronicum poisonous

 

A perennial herbaceous plant of the asteraceae (complex-flowered) family. It has a creeping rhizome thickened at the nodes. Stems are simple or branched, glandular-pubescent, 50-120 cm tall. Basal leaves (two of them) and lower stem leaves — with long winged petioles, cordate, entire, pubescent; middle stems – short-petiolate, almost ovoid, with two ears at the base, notched-toothed along the edge; upper leaves are sessile, heart-shaped, stem-wrapping, ovate-lanceolate, pubescent. The flowers are small, collected in baskets (several baskets, rarely single); marginal flowers are placed in one row, pistillate, ligulate, golden yellow; median – tubular, bisexual, numerous. The fruit is an achene. Blooms from July to September.

Distribution . Poison ivy grows in the Carpathians in forests, coastal shrubs, near streams.

Procurement and storage . For medicinal purposes, flower baskets of sugaynika are used, which are harvested at the beginning of the flowering of the plant, when the reed flowers are directed upwards. The collected baskets are laid out in one layer on paper or fabric under shelter in the open air or in a ventilated room and dried. The finished raw materials are stored in tightly closed cans or cans in a dry, dark place.

The plant is unofficial .

Chemical composition. The flower baskets of the sugainik contain essential oil, bitter substances, xanthophyll dye and an unknown substance with irritating properties.

Pharmacological properties and use . The infusion of poison ivy baskets is given internally in the same cases as the infusion of mountain arnica flower baskets. Externally, the infusion of sugaynik baskets is used for neuralgia and rheumatism.
